[PATCH -RT 4.x] net: xfrm: fix compress vs decompress serialization

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



A crash was seen in xfrm when running ltp's 'tcp4_ipsec06' stresser on v4.x
based RT kernels.

ipcomp_compress() will serialize access to the ipcomp_scratches percpu buffer by
disabling BH and preventing a softirq from coming in and running ipcom_decompress(),
which is never called from process context. This of course won't work on RT and
the buffer can get corrupted; there have been similar issues with in the past with
such assumptions, ie: ebf255ed6c44 (net: add back the missing serialization in
ip_send_unicast_reply()).

Similarly, this patch addresses the issue with locallocks allowing RT to have a
percpu spinlock and do the correct serialization.
